Biography

Jean began her formal art training in high school at St. Cecelia Academy in Nashville and continued with an art scholarship in New Orleans. Upon returning to Nashville she studied at the Watkins Institute while working in advertising and as a retail display artist.  Jean is married and is the mother of 8 children, grandmother to 24 and has one great grandchild. In recent years Jean joined the Cheekwood Garden and Art Museum classes and The Chestnut Group "Plein Air Painters for the Land." Jean's paintings hang in homes and offices throughout the United States and Europe. She has studied with such renowned painters as Matt Smith, Janson Saunders, Ralph Olberg, Skip Whitecomb, and Dan Young.
